diff options
author | Kristian Aune <kkraune@users.noreply.github.com> | 2017-10-06 13:17:23 +0200 |
---|---|---|
committer | GitHub <noreply@github.com> | 2017-10-06 13:17:23 +0200 |
commit | 6e58fe858405fdb046cdecb433ed01f231060446 (patch) | |
tree | a099f89b601b2c724d0542231c98e3b301672bf9 /config-model | |
parent | f4b28c8546e0a14d6259fb14f7f33ce049eaf7e9 (diff) | |
parent | 2233354c32c245dda2779e168ee721744b7f06a4 (diff) |
Merge pull request #3670 from vespa-engine/balder/remove-summary-maxdiskbloatfactor
Remove maxdiskbloatfactor.
Diffstat (limited to 'config-model')
3 files changed, 3 insertions, 7 deletions
diff --git a/config-model/src/main/java/com/yahoo/vespa/model/builder/xml/dom/DomSearchTuningBuilder.java b/config-model/src/main/java/com/yahoo/vespa/model/builder/xml/dom/DomSearchTuningBuilder.java index 4e66368ef73..ba89169fc4c 100644 --- a/config-model/src/main/java/com/yahoo/vespa/model/builder/xml/dom/DomSearchTuningBuilder.java +++ b/config-model/src/main/java/com/yahoo/vespa/model/builder/xml/dom/DomSearchTuningBuilder.java @@ -245,7 +245,9 @@ public class DomSearchTuningBuilder extends VespaDomBuilder.DomConfigProducerBui if (equals("maxfilesize", e)) { s.logStore.maxFileSize = asLong(e); } else if (equals("maxdiskbloatfactor", e)) { - s.logStore.maxDiskBloatFactor = asDouble(e); + parent.deployLogger().log(Level.WARNING, + "Element 'maxdiskbloatfactor is deprecated and ignored." + + " The min value from flush.memory.xxx.diskbloatfactor is used instead"); } else if (equals("minfilesizefactor", e)) { s.logStore.minFileSizeFactor = asDouble(e); } else if (equals("numthreads", e)) { diff --git a/config-model/src/main/java/com/yahoo/vespa/model/search/Tuning.java b/config-model/src/main/java/com/yahoo/vespa/model/search/Tuning.java index 7c40acd91ee..17af4030cb6 100644 --- a/config-model/src/main/java/com/yahoo/vespa/model/search/Tuning.java +++ b/config-model/src/main/java/com/yahoo/vespa/model/search/Tuning.java @@ -282,14 +282,12 @@ public class Tuning extends AbstractConfigProducer implements PartitionsConfig.P public static class LogStore { public Long maxFileSize = null; - public Double maxDiskBloatFactor = null; public Integer numThreads = null; public Component chunk = null; public Double minFileSizeFactor = null; public void getConfig(ProtonConfig.Summary.Log.Builder log) { if (maxFileSize!=null) log.maxfilesize(maxFileSize); - if (maxDiskBloatFactor!=null) log.maxdiskbloatfactor(maxDiskBloatFactor); if (minFileSizeFactor!=null) log.minfilesizefactor(minFileSizeFactor); if (numThreads != null) log.numthreads(numThreads); if (chunk != null) { @@ -304,7 +302,6 @@ public class Tuning extends AbstractConfigProducer implements PartitionsConfig.P public void getConfig(ProtonConfig.Summary.Builder builder) { if (cache != null) { cache.getConfig(builder.cache); - } if (logStore != null) { logStore.getConfig(builder.log); diff --git a/config-model/src/test/java/com/yahoo/vespa/model/builder/xml/dom/DomSearchTuningBuilderTest.java b/config-model/src/test/java/com/yahoo/vespa/model/builder/xml/dom/DomSearchTuningBuilderTest.java index f421cbd84db..613827d2cf1 100644 --- a/config-model/src/test/java/com/yahoo/vespa/model/builder/xml/dom/DomSearchTuningBuilderTest.java +++ b/config-model/src/test/java/com/yahoo/vespa/model/builder/xml/dom/DomSearchTuningBuilderTest.java @@ -184,7 +184,6 @@ public class DomSearchTuningBuilderTest extends DomBuilderTest { "</cache>", "<logstore>", "<maxfilesize>512</maxfilesize>", - "<maxdiskbloatfactor>1.4</maxdiskbloatfactor>", "<minfilesizefactor>0.3</minfilesizefactor>", "<numthreads>7</numthreads>", "<chunk>", @@ -204,7 +203,6 @@ public class DomSearchTuningBuilderTest extends DomBuilderTest { t.searchNode.summary.store.cache.compression.type); assertEquals(3, t.searchNode.summary.store.cache.compression.level.intValue()); assertEquals(512, t.searchNode.summary.store.logStore.maxFileSize.longValue()); - assertEquals(1.4, t.searchNode.summary.store.logStore.maxDiskBloatFactor, DELTA); assertEquals(0.3, t.searchNode.summary.store.logStore.minFileSizeFactor, DELTA); assertEquals(7, t.searchNode.summary.store.logStore.numThreads.intValue()); assertEquals(256, t.searchNode.summary.store.logStore.chunk.maxSize.intValue()); @@ -219,7 +217,6 @@ public class DomSearchTuningBuilderTest extends DomBuilderTest { assertThat(cfg, containsString("summary.cache.compression.type NONE")); assertThat(cfg, containsString("summary.cache.compression.level 3")); assertThat(cfg, containsString("summary.log.maxfilesize 512")); - assertThat(cfg, containsString("summary.log.maxdiskbloatfactor 1.4")); assertThat(cfg, containsString("summary.log.minfilesizefactor 0.3")); assertThat(cfg, containsString("summary.log.chunk.maxbytes 256")); assertThat(cfg, containsString("summary.log.chunk.compression.type LZ4")); |